NAME Ahpatinin G
FORMULA C41H61N5O9
MOLECULAR WEIGHT (Da) 767.9650
ACCURATE MASS (Da) 767.4469
ORIGIN ORGANISM TYPE Bacterium
ORIGIN GENUS Streptomyces
ORIGIN SPECIES sp. WK-142
InChIKey MFWIJLUBDHGRLX-UHFFFAOYSA-N
InChI InChI=1S/C41H61N5O9/c1-24(2)19-34(49)45-37(25(3)4)41(54)46-38(26(5)6)40(53)44-30(20-28-15-11-9-12-16-28)32(47)22-35(50)42-27(7)39(52)43-31(33(48)23-36(51)55-8)21-29-17-13-10-14-18-29/h9-18,24-27,30-33,37-38,47-48H,19-23H2,1-8H3,(H,42,50)(H,43,52)(H,44,53)(H,45,49)(H,46,54)
SMILES CC(C)CC(=O)NC(C(C)C)C(=O)NC(C(C)C)C(=O)NC(CC1=CC=CC=C1)C(CC(=O)NC(C)C(=O)NC(CC2=CC=CC=C2)C(CC(=O)OC)O)O
ORIGINAL ISOLATION REFERENCE
CITATION Omura S; Imamura N; Kawakita K; Mori Y; Yamazaki Y; Masuma R; Takahashi Y; Tanaka H; Huang LY; Woodruff HB AHPATININS, NEW ACID PROTEASE INHIBITORS CONTAINING 4-AMINO-3-HYDROXY-5-PHENYLPENTANOIC ACID Journal of Antibiotics 1986 39 (8) 1079-1085.
DOI 10.7164/antibiotics.39.1079 PMID 3093433
